More lenders go under 3%

Announcement posted by Infochoice 03 Nov 2019

There are options for savers who want to beat inflation

More lenders have trimmed variable and fixed home loan rates to under three per cent.

“There are now 18 variable home loan rates for owner-occupiers starting with a 2,” said Vadim Taube, CEO of leading Australian financial comparison site InfoChoice.com.au,

“If your loan is charging you three and half or four per cent per annum, you are not getting anywhere near the lowest rate deal now available.

“Borrowers can now lock in sub-3 per cent home loan rates until 2024 with more long fixed-rate deals now coming down into the 2 per cent zone,” said Vadim Taube.

“Currently, savers can’t get an ongoing rate significantly above inflation from the big four banks, in either at-call accounts or term deposits.”

“Savers really need to be looking at some of the easy-to-open, online accounts to get the most competitive rates in the market,” said Vadim Taube, CEO of leading Australian financial comparison site InfoChoice.com.au.

“Judo Bank has market leading rates in the term deposit market and Greater Bank, ME, UBank, Bank Australia and BoQ are among the leaders in the at-call ongoing incentive saver market.
